Fehlermeldungen
Die häufigsten Datenbank-Fehlermeldungen und wie man sie beheben kann
Datenbank-Fehlermeldungen können bei der Arbeit mit MySQL oder anderen relationalen Datenbanken auftreten. Hier sind einige der bekanntesten Fehlermeldungen und Tipps, wie du sie beheben kannst:
Access Denied for User
Ursache:
Diese Fehlermeldung tritt auf, wenn der Benutzername oder das Passwort für den Zugriff auf die Datenbank falsch ist oder der Benutzer nicht die notwendigen Berechtigungen hat.
Lösung:
- Überprüfe, ob der Benutzername und das Passwort korrekt sind.
- Stelle sicher, dass der Benutzer über ausreichende Berechtigungen für die angegebene Datenbank verfügt.
- Überprüfe die Konfigurationsdatei (z. B. config.php oder wp-config.php), um sicherzustellen, dass die Anmeldeinformationen korrekt eingetragen sind.
Unknown Database databasename
Ursache:
Die Datenbank, auf die du zugreifen möchtest, existiert nicht oder der Name wurde falsch geschrieben.
Lösung:
- Überprüfe, ob der Datenbankname korrekt ist.
- Erstelle die Datenbank, falls sie noch nicht existiert, mit dem Befehl:
CREATE DATABASE databasename;
Too Many Connections
Ursache:
Diese Fehlermeldung tritt auf, wenn zu viele gleichzeitige Verbindungen zur Datenbank bestehen und das Limit erreicht wurde. Jede Datenbank hat ein festgelegtes Limit für gleichzeitige Verbindungen.
Lösung:
- Überprüfe die Anwendung auf unnötige, offene Datenbankverbindungen und schließe sie nach dem Gebrauch.
- Du kannst das Verbindungs-Limit in der MySQL-Konfiguration erhöhen (z. B. in der Datei my.cnf):
max_connections = 200
Table tablename doesn't exist
Ursache:
Diese Fehlermeldung erscheint, wenn eine Tabelle in der Datenbank nicht gefunden wird. Dies kann daran liegen, dass die Tabelle nicht existiert, gelöscht wurde oder der Name falsch geschrieben ist.
Lösung:
-
Überprüfe, ob die Tabelle existiert:
SHOW TABLES;
-
Falls sie nicht existiert, erstelle sie mit den entsprechenden Feldern oder importiere sie neu, falls sie versehentlich gelöscht wurde.
Diese Datenbank-Fehlermeldungen sind häufig und lassen sich oft schnell beheben, wenn man die Ursachen kennt. Indem du die Fehlermeldung genau analysierst, kannst du das Problem identifizieren und deine Datenbank effizienter verwalten.